Synopsis

Kusunoki Taiga (played by Matsumoto Jun) was born as the second son of Kusunoki Koutarou, a renowned actor representing Japan, and chose to follow in his father’s footsteps as an actor. However, his work as an actor is virtually non-existent, with most of his jobs being variety show appearances as a celebrity’s son. Since he was little, he has been called “Kusunoki Koutarou’s son” and mocked as “riding on his father’s coattails,” lamenting that his own identity has been continuously stripped away. His overly intellectual and argumentative nature also works against him, causing him to become overly concerned with trivial matters, such as how a woman holds her chopsticks, resulting in his relationships never lasting long.

One day, to blow off steam, Taiga enjoys his hobby of skydiving with his friend Keita, who is also a second-generation actor. Suddenly, his parachute malfunctions, and Taiga is carried far away from the drop point. He ends up getting caught in a large tree in a thicket near the sea, hanging in midair and unable to move! As he struggles helplessly, a beautiful woman (played by Takeuchi Yuko) happens to pass by…
